A way to uninstall Internet Download Manager from your computer

This page contains detailed information on how to remove Internet Download Manager for Windows. It was created for Windows by IDM. Check out here for more information on IDM. Please open if you want to read more on Internet Download Manager on IDM's website. Usually the Internet Download Manager program is placed in the C:\Program Files\Internet Download Manager directory, depending on the user's option during install. You can remove Internet Download Manager by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Program Files\Internet Download Manager\unins000.exe. Keep in mind that you might be prompted for administrator rights. The program's main executable file occupies 22.05 KB (22584 bytes) on disk and is titled MediumILStart.exe.

The executables below are part of Internet Download Manager. They take about 1.17 MB (1226852 bytes) on disk.

  • MediumILStart.exe (22.05 KB)
  • unins000.exe (1.15 MB)
